Green Building Alliance is a Pittsburgh-based nonprofit focused on advancing sustainability in the commercial building sector. Founded in 1993, it has evolved into a recognized authority on high-performance building practices, aiming to transform how planning, construction, and ongoing operation occur so spaces are healthy for people and the environment while supporting a robust economy. The organization's programs span technical assistance for projects and communities, credentialing and upskilling for sustainable practices, guidance on innovative financing, and support for manufacturers seeking greater energy, water efficiency, waste reduction, and product sustainability; it also helps connect manufacturers with designers and procurement professionals through product showcases.

It operates regionally and beyond through strategic alliances and initiatives, including managing the Pittsburgh 2030 District, the largest of its kind in North America. In 2019, Pittsburgh was designated as the second UN International Center of Excellence on High-Performance Building, a development tied to GBA's activities. The alliance collaborates with networks and organizations such as the 2030 District Network, the United Nations, the International Living Future Institute, and national and international green building councils to advance standards and markets for sustainable products and practices.
